Transaction 18d89694442431cfc24b488422ab14aa609196685a6e299e983739c4102b1474

1 Input
2 Outputs
  • 18d89694442431cfc24b488422ab14aa609196685a6e299e983739c4102b1474:0
  • value  445615
    address  32SPZAc6NMwFZNYCfqqcw11zuqg1T9LFoX
  • 18d89694442431cfc24b488422ab14aa609196685a6e299e983739c4102b1474:1
  • value  7896500
    address  1J44M18U3emxrPRcHM8bD4GN2nfZp9Wdrp